Another way to earn money as a real estate agent is to manage the properties for homeowners and investors. This job includes managing, maintaining and repairing the properties, finding renters, collecting rent and keeping a close eye on accounting.According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the average real estate agent earns $45,990 each year, but the range in income is massive. One-tenth of real estate agents earned less than $23,000, and 10% earned more than $110,000. It states that the most challenging part of sales, according to polled salespeople, is; Firstly prospecting (40%), then closing (36%), and thirdly qualifying (22%). The truth : After a sale goes through, real estate agents and their brokers have to wait til closing to get paid. This can take up to 30 – 60 days more after the initial sale is made. So if you’re a new real estate agent wondering when you can expect a commission check, it won’t be right after you sign that next deal.Feb 25, 2020 · 1. Real estate is a regulated profession in Ontario, so all real estate agents must be registered with the Real Estate Council of Ontario (RECO). RECO regulates the real estate brokerages and agents who trade in real estate in Ontario. If you are interested in becoming a real estate agent, the information below will ... Yes. Super easy. The most common pro I hear from people who are … Biggest surprise for folks is that the single most important activity for a real estate agent has little to do with homes, it's actually lead generation. It's a sales job. You just happen to sell homes. Typical day needs to start with contacting people, talking about real estate, asking for business and how you would be the best fit for the job.
